Barton, Barton Court
Early-attested site in the Parish of Abingdon and St Helen Without
Historical Forms
- Bertune 1086 DB 1428–9 ObAcc
- Barton 1761 Rocque
Etymology
Barton, Barton Court, Bertune 1086 DBet freq with variant spellings Berton , Berton ', la Berton ' to 1428–9 ObAcc, Barton 1761 Rocque, 'grange', v. beretūn . Cf. also Wynnerd Barton , Wyneyard Barton , Tithing called Wyniard Bartone 1608Dep , v. supra 436.
